Warning Signs You Need Laminate Floor Water Extraction

Don’t ignore the warning signs of water damage on your laminate floor.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old or mildew on your laminate floor. If you notice a musty smell that persists even after cleaning, it’s time to call us for Laminate Floor Water Extraction.

Warped or Buckled Laminate Flooring

Water damage can cause laminate flooring to warp or buckle, creating uneven surfaces and tripping hazards. If you notice your laminate floor is warped or buckled,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.

Discoloration or Staining

Water damage can cause discoloration or staining on your laminate floor, making it look dull and unappealing. If you notice any discoloration or staining, it’s time to call us for Laminate Floor Water Extraction.

Water Stains or Rings

Water stains or rings on your laminate floor can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any water stains or rings,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Soft or Spongy Laminate Flooring

Water damage can cause laminate flooring to become soft or spongy to the touch. If you notice your laminate floor feels soft or spongy, it’s time to call us for Laminate Floor Water Extraction.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age on your laminate floor can be a sign of a more significant issue. If you notice water damage on your laminate floor,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
